AI Technical Summary
Technical Problem
Existing balcony glazing arrangements face issues with window deflection and strain on carriages and frame components due to weight when turned open, affecting functionality, appearance, and increasing material and assembly costs.
Method used
A continuous hinge pin system is used, with non-rotatably connected ends to the frame head and sill, allowing contraction onto a vertical side rail, minimizing play and eliminating the need for a vertical frame jamb, and utilizing bushings and fasteners to stabilize and reduce friction.
Benefits of technology
This design enhances the appearance, functionality, and reduces material and assembly costs by minimizing deflection and improving the feel of opening and closing operations.
